<div class="standfirst">A new device the size of a BlackBerry could help check  patients&#8217; genetic suitability to different medicines</div>
<p>British scientists are testing a prototype of the device, which could be on  the market in two years.</p>
<p>The SNP (pronounced snip) Doctor can analyse DNA to tell if a patient has the  right genetic fit for a particular drug from a drop of saliva or cheek swab.</p>
<p>It looks for known single nucleotide polymorphisms (SNPs) &#8211; single letter  changes in the genetic code &#8211; that can affect a person&#8217;s response to medical  treatment.</p>
<p>Each year the NHS spends around£460 million dealing with the 250,000 patients  who are admitted to hospital suffering adverse reactions to prescribed drugs,  from dizziness and nausea to heart palpitations or loss of consciousness.</p>
<p>Being able to predict these responses to drugs such as antidepressants or  cholesterol-lowering statins would allow doctors to tailor treatment to  individual patients.</p>
<p>Scientists at <a title="Imperial College London" href="http://www3.imperial.ac.uk/" target="_blank">Imperial  College London</a> and <a title="DNA Electronics" href="http://www.dnae.co.uk/" target="_blank">DNA  Electronics</a> are now carrying out further trials.</p>
<p>Professor Chris Toumazou, who heads the Imperial College team, said: &#8216;It  could provide another layer in the treatment process that could help GPs to  personalise treatments according to the genetic requirements of each  patient.&#8217;</p>
